Labour — Doncaster East and the Isle of Axholme

Speaking in the House of Commons on 15 September 2026

Debate

Civil Service Pension Scheme

Contribution

This Capita situation is not acceptable. I have constituents who have served for decades who are now living off their savings because they cannot get a response from Capita, never mind the pension payments that they are owed. Others have had to borrow money from friends and family just to make ends meet, and have no idea when this will be resolved. One person worked for 30 years in the prison service. In September, he received a letter promising that he would receive his pension “by the end of August”. Those are not isolated examples. I have received hundreds of emails—about 400 in total. Whatever uniform they wore, and whatever office they worked in, they worked hard, they paid in, and they planned for their retirement on the understanding that the pension they had earned would be there when they needed it most. They have kept their side of the bargain; it is time the system kept its side, too. I ask the Minister to lay out the plans and timescales for getting this resolved for my constituents.
